Oyo State, Nigeria – In yet another deeply disturbing incident, a video showing schoolchildren fleeing in absolute panic while desperately shouting “Where are the bandits?” has gone viral, sparking fresh outrage across the country.…....
The footage captures terrified students in school uniforms running helter-skelter after rumours of an imminent bandit attack spread through their community. Instead of order and reassurance, chaos erupted as the children scattered in fear, screaming for safety. One voice in the video heartbreakingly asks, “Where are the bandits?” – a painful cry that reflects the growing frustration and helplessness felt by many Nigerians.
This latest scare comes shortly after armed bandits attacked schools in Oriire Local Government Area of Oyo State, where several students and teachers were abducted and at least one teacher was brutally beheaded in a video that shocked the nation.
Parents and residents are now openly questioning the safety of schools in the region. “Maybe students should no longer go to school because of what is happening,” many have lamented, highlighting how banditry has turned education into a life-threatening ordeal in parts of Nigeria.
The recurring attacks have left communities traumatised, with schools in affected areas considering temporary closure as fear continues to grip students, teachers, and parents alike.
